Climate Change

A debate where the Bloc leader implied the current Liberal government is not doing enough on climate change compared to when Trudeau was in charge, and the Liberal member defended their record and team's commitment to the environment. The Bloc leader criticized past Liberal moves like pipelines and accused them of lacking seriousness, while the Liberal focused on Canada's global leadership and recent nature protection moves.
